The particular name of an igneous rocks consisting of minerals is best determined using the chart in the lab book and noting:___
Yanka [14]

Answer:

C, the relative color

Explanation:

Color indicates the composition of a rock or mineral.  A felsic composition is indicated by light colors such as white or pink.  Intermediate rocks or minerals have a medium color such as gray or an equal part of dark and light colored minerals . Mafic or ultramafic rocks or minerals are dark colored such as black or brown however they might also contain light colored minerals within them.

What is time-space convergence ​
brilliants [131]

Answer: It refers to the decline in travel time between geographical locations as a result of transportation, communication, and related technological and social innovations.
